Compare and contrast the time complexities of searching in a balanced binary search tree and a hash table.
Q: Let G = (V, E) denote an weighted undirected graph, in which every edge has unit weight, and let T =…
A: In graph theory, a graph G is represented as G = (V, E), where V is the set of vertices and E is the…
Q: Does the proc panel in SAS account for TIME dummy variables?
A: Panel data analysis, which involves examining data gathered over time from a group of people or…
Q: Describe the workings of a self-balancing binary search tree.
A: Self-balancing binary search trees are a specialized type of data structure that aims to maintain…
Q: Explain alpha Beta pruning on the following diagram MAX MIN MAX MIN L E M B 3 N 3 F 0 P C 3 H Q/ R\…
A: Alpha beta pruning is an optimization technique for the minmax algorithm. This technique reduces the…
Q: Write a pseudocode function to describe an algorithm where the stored data can be searched for a…
A: Write a pseudocode function to describe an algorithm where the stored data can be searched for a…
Q: Task 1: Consider the following pseudocode function that describes the R0 Search algorithm: function…
A: The best-case inputs are those that cause the algorithm to execute with the optimal performance.The…
Q: Although merge sort runs in (n lgn) worst-case time and insertion sort runs in (n²) worst-case time,…
A: The questions revolve around the modification of the Merge Sort algorithm by incorporating Insertion…
Q: Consider the following edge-weighted graph G with 9 vertices and 16 edges. 90 Q6.1 Kruskal 0 40 50…
A: According to the information given:-We have to follow the Kruskal algo and find the MST edges.
Q: or the following heap that is stored as an array, for the options, select the choice that correctly…
A: We are given a heap tree and its nodes are stored in an array and array has its index.Index is used…
Q: Label the Recursion Requirements. int fact (int n) { int result; } if(n==1) return 1; result = fact…
A: Recursion in programming is a method where the solution to a problem depends on solutions to smaller…
Q: ID Checking balance Accounts startedDate Saving ID CATE TABLE OPERATIONS( CHAR(10), Dunt…
A: An ER (Entity-Relationship) diagram is a visual representation that depicts the relationships and…
Q: How does the choice of a data structure influence the performance and scalability of an application?
A: The choice of a data structure is a critical decision in software development, as it can…
Q: How come arrays are so helpful to have around?
A: Arrays are a fundamental CPU science data structure that stores elements of the similar data type in…
Q: 0 Mohave 12 La Paz 11 Yavapai 14 Maricopa Coconino 13 Yuma 2 Navajo 10 Gila 8 Pinal (13 7 Pima 12 9…
A: In this question, we have to implement a graph data structure in Java. the must define a Graph class…
Q: 10 7 15 6 17 12
A: We are given a min heap and we have to insert a new node which have value 3. After inserting node 3…
Q: Question 4 wasnt answered please
A: The complete code is given below with Question 4 included
Q: Given a singly linked list of integers, reverse the nodes of the linked list 'k' at a time and…
A: Create three pointers pre, cur, and nex to reverse each group. Iterate through the linked list until…
Q: Explain the significance of space-time tradeoff in the context of data structure and algorithm…
A: When creating algorithms and data structures, the space-time tradeoff is a key idea in computer…
Q: In this day and age of artificial intelligence and machine learning, do algorithms and data…
A: The Continued Relevance of Algorithms and Data Structures in the AI AgeIn the face of the incredible…
Q: What would a Unified Modeling Language (UML) diagram of the program below look like? Source Code:…
A: The UML Class diagram is a graphical representation of classes, their attributes, methods, and the…
Q: QUESTION 3 55 34 y 29 43 E 33 45 Find the total weights using edge-picking algorithm. 21 50 B 26 75…
A: Edge picking algorithm is an algorithm that is used to find out the efficient Hamiltonian circuits…
Q: 1. Give the best possible asymptotic upper bounds for the following recurrence rel Prove your…
A: To find the asymptotic upper bounds for the given recurrence relations, we can use the Master…
Q: Formally prove or disprove the following claim, using any method T(n) = 4T(n/2) + n is (n^2)
A: In this question we have been given a recurrence relation claim where we need to disprove or prove…
Q: 3. Draw the shortest-path tree for the single-source all-destinations shortest path rooted at vs.…
A: A shortest path tree in a graph is a tree-shaped arrangement that illustrates the shortest routes…
Q: 1. Write a Graph class in Java This class should represent undirected graphs. You can choose one of…
A: According to the Bartleby guidelines, we are supposed to answer only one question at a time.Kindly…
Q: What would you say in a PowerPoint presentation that illustrates how graph theory is used to answer…
A: Slide 1:IntroductionThe Seven Bridges of Königsberg problemExploring how Graph Theory helps solve…
Q: How can one evaluate the state of an ArrayList to assess how effectively it is functioning?
A: The efficiency of an ArrayList is primarily measured by its performance in executing various…
Q: s there any inbuilt function in JAVA for the binary search algorithm that searches a key in a sorted…
A: There is a inbuilt function called "indexOf()" which can be able to search a specific key element…
Q: Difference between Array and Linked List?
A: arrays and linked lists have different characteristics and are suitable for different scenarios.…
Q: Consider 90 Q6.1 Kruskal 40 50 80 130 Your answer should be a cog 110 70 S 150 60 30 10 120 140 20…
A: Kruskal's algorithm is a greedy algorithm used to find the minimum spanning tree (MST) of a…
Q: Contrast the stack data structure with other data structures, such as queues or linked lists. What…
A: Of course, let's compare stack data with two other commonly used data types: queue and linked…
Q: illustrate the execution of the in-place heap sort algorithm in the following input sequence: {2, 5,…
A: illustrate the execution of the in-place heap sort algorithm in the following inputsequence:{2, 5,…
Q: Consider using an array as a dictionary. Now assume the peculiar situation that the client may…
A: In the peculiar scenario of using an array as a dictionary, where multiple insert operations are…
Q: Consider the following edge-weighted graph G with 9 vertices and 16 edges: 90 Q6.1 Kruskal 40 50 80…
A: Kruskal algorithmThe Kruskal algorithm(greedy algorithm) are used to find the MST(minimum spanning…
Q: Task - 2: Write a java program (AnyTypeMergeSort.java) to implement the Merge Sort algorithm to sort…
A: The complete JAVA code is given below with output screenshotAlgorithm: Merge SortCheck if the size…
Q: [Problem 9] Run the Dijkstra's algorithm on the following graph and find all shortest paths between…
A: Dijkstra's algorithm is an algorithm that is used to find out the shortest distances from the source…
Q: Apply suitable graph traversal technique which uses queue as a supporting component to carry out the…
A: In this question we have to apply a suitable graph traversal technique which uses queue as a…
Q: You are given N cents (integer N) Break up N cents into coins of 1 cent, 2 cent, 5 cents. Using a…
A: When given an amount of money represented in cents, the task is to break it down into the fewest…
Q: Can you use Python programming language to to this question? Thanks Please write a program which…
A: 1. Start2. Ask the user to input a string3. Store the string in a variable called "string"4. If the…
Q: Theory Sort the following from slowest growth rate to fastest growth rate. Let f(x) grow slower than…
A: The functions are arranged from slowest to the fastest (from left to right) as below:The first…
Q: Create a PowerPoint presentation in which you describe how to insert an element into a singly-linked…
A: A singly-linked list is a line data fostering storing components in nodes. Each protuberance…
Q: A 10 B 40 20 80 30 D a) Uniform-Cost-Search (UCS) is an algorithm that uses the path cost to…
A: Uninformed Search:Uninformed search strategies, also known as blind search strategies, operate…
Q: . Implement a Reference-Based ADT Stack and verify "isEmpty()", "push()", "pop()", "popAll()", and…
A: An Abstract Data Type (ADT) is a high-level description of a data structure that specifies the…
Q: The challenge you have in front of you now, is to perform additional actions to attachments such as,…
A: import java.util.LinkedList;import java.util.List;import java.util.Queue;import java.util.UUID;class…
Q: Write java program to store any given graph using the following strategies: Task 3. Adjacency List…
A: Problem:It is asked to create the adjacency list for the graph implementation. According to other…
Q: Problem 1. Construct a non-recursive procedure capable of reversing a single linked list of n…
A: In this question we have been asked about the pseudocode for the following set of questions…
Q: 0 Mohave 12 La Paz 15 15 11 Yavapai 14 Maricopa Coconino 13 Yuma 2 Navajo 10 Gila 8 Pinal 7 Pima 9…
A: The graph is an undirected graph and hence we can represent it as in adjacency list format where the…
Q: For this project, you will implement a binary search tree and use it to store a large text file…
A: In this question we have to write a java program for the given problem statement to implement a…
Q: C PROGRAMMING PLEASE FOLLOW THE INSTRUCTIONS AND MAKE SURE THE OUTPUT MATCHES THE EXPECTED OUTPUT!…
A: #include <stdio.h>#include <stdlib.h>typedef struct node{ char letter; struct node…
Q: What is the worst case propagation delay of the circuit below? Assume that the propagation delay of…
A: In digital circuits, the propagation delay is the time it takes for a signal to propagate from one…
Step by step
Solved in 5 steps